This opportunity awards scholarships to academically talented and highly motivated full-time African-American or Black students pursuing an undergraduate, graduate or doctoral degrees in a variety of fields.
AWARD:
Varies
DEADLINES:
04/30/2022
ELIGIBILITY REQUIREMENTS:
- Be a U.S. citizen or legal permanent resident
- Permanent residence or attend academic institution in a CBC Members district
- Preparing to pursue or currently pursuing an undergraduate, graduate or doctoral degree full-time at an accredited college or university. Current high school seniors are also eligible to apply.
- Have a minimum 2.5 GPA on 4.0 scale
- Exhibit leadership and be active in community
- Selected applicants will be qualified African-American or black students
APPLICATION REQUIREMENTS:
- Complete 2-part online application must be submitted by 11:59 pm on the deadline date.
- Video Response: Personal Statement
- 2 Letter of Recommendations
- Transcript(s) – must be directly uploaded into application system Academic Works
- Resume listing work experience, extracurricular activities, honors, community service and special skills
- A recent professional photograph suitable for publication (ie. A graduation or other professional quality photograph in which the dress is formal)
